1.(想法、感觉、信息)蔓延,逐渐流传
If an idea, feeling, or piece of informationpercolates through a group of people or a thing, it spreads slowly through the group or thing.
e.g. New fashions took a long time topercolate down.
新时尚要很长时间才能在大众中流行起来。
e.g. ...all of these thoughts percolated through my mind.
所有这些想法在我脑海中扩散
2.(用渗滤式咖啡壶滤煮)
When youpercolate coffee or when coffeepercolates, you prepare it in a percolator.
e.g. She percolated the coffee and put croissants in the oven to warm.
她滤煮好咖啡,然后把羊角面包放进烤箱加热。
3.渗透;渗漏;渗入
Topercolate somewhere means to pass slowly through something that has very small holes or gaps in it.
e.g. Rain water will onlypercolate through slowly.
雨水只会慢慢地渗进来。
